What is the relation between Venset and p-glycoprotein?
Pglycoprotein plays a crucial role in eliminating Venset from the brain Numerous research studies have indicated that both Venset and its metabolite have the potential to inhibit the action of pglycoprotein This interaction between Venset and pglycoprotein has raised significant interest in the scientific community The expulsion of Venset from the brain is of particular importance due to its potential influence on drug effectiveness and overall therapeutic outcomes Pglycoprotein a membrane protein acts as a transporter actively removing various substances including drugs from the brain By understanding the mechanisms involved in this expulsion researchers can gain valuable insights into how to enhance drug delivery and optimize treatment strategies The inhibitory effect of Venset and its metabolite on pglycoprotein has been observed through various experimental approaches These findings suggest that Venset could potentially alter the pharmacokinetics and pharmacodynamics of other drugs that are substrates of pglycoprotein Consequently this interaction may have implications for drugdrug interactions and therapeutic efficacy Further investigations into this complex interplay between Venset and pglycoprotein are warranted to fully understand the underlying mechanisms and potential clinical implications Future research could focus on elucidating the precise binding sites and molecular interactions involved in this inhibition as well as exploring strategies to modulate pglycoprotein activity for improved drug delivery to the brain Ultimately these endeavors could lead to enhanced treatment options for various neurological conditions
